Developed, in close collaboration with newsroom, technology, and business units, Health Vertical with original and licensed content in wellness and disease, as a major destination portal for consumers of health information. Products include:

  • Health Guide – licensed reference covering 3,000+ conditions and 100 in-depth reports on the most common diseases, coupled with NY Times news, features, and multimedia
  • Times Essentials – original reports published in weekly series, covering 100 conditions, interpreting the news and connecting seamlessly with licensed reference content. Each set of reports includes Reporter’s File, Expert Q&A, Questions for Your Doctor, 5 Things to Know, and Clinical Trials.
  • Consults – blog in which top academic MDs discuss the latest news and take readers’ questions on diabetes, heart failure, stroke, cancer, lung disease, and Alzheimers.
  • Patient Voices – audio slide series with patients talking about their experience with diseases and other conditions; interpretive graphics.
  • Well – Tara Parker-Pope sifts through medical research and expert opinions for practical advice to help readers take control of their health; includes blog, weekly column, podcast, and video.
  • Personal Best – Gina Kolata’s column on high-performance workouts and fitness.
  • The New Old Age: Caring & Coping – Jane Gross’s blog providing expert advice and navigation for the 70+ million U.S.seniors and their baby-boomer caregivers.
  • Recipes for Health – new column on menu planning and daily recipes; forthcoming: a healthy eating video blog, user-submitted healthy recipes, and a recipe nutrition analyzer.
